No doubt a fusion would do a fine job with any good broadside shot on an elk..Shoot 'em in the lungs and they die just like anything else. However, you may not be fortunate enough to get a nice broadside shot at a standing elk. Elk are much bigger than deer and they are just flat out tougher to kill, unless hit perfectly. What if the only shot you get at a bull is quartering away ? You might have to drive a bullet through a lot of tissue to reach the vitals. It makes sense to me to use a more heavily constructed bullet that will smash heavy bones and penetrate far enough to reach the vitals on a ranging shot or other less than perfect shot angle.

It's not the "Unsafe Act", Chef... For many years NY has required that a semi-auto to be used for big game must have a capacity of 6 rounds or less, limiting the magazine capacity to 5 rounds.

If I didn't reload I'd probably use a .308 Win or a 30-06 simply because of the variety and availability of factory loads available. I am not a fan of the belted magnums. They are by nature not very efficient, and burn a lot more powder ( along with increased recoil and muzzle blast) in relationship to their increase in performance. They do have their niche, which is usually best served by using heavy for caliber bullets at long range.. However, for most shooting at ranges of 400 yards or less, standard chamberings will do the same thing with less powder, commotion, expense, and meat damage. My personal favorite...The .280 Remington.

Barrel length is probably the biggest factor in muzzle blast...18 or 19 inch 7mm08 barrels are LOUD !! Noticeably louder than a 30-06 with a 22 or 24 inch barrel.

I have only ever hunted with one muzzleloader, a TC Hawken .50 cal. that my ex-wife bought me for my birthday in 1973. I used it for years with the factory sights until my eyes got too old for them. I installed an aftermarket tang peep sight, which I still use today.. For years I shot PRBs with 90 grains of 2F blackpowder or pyrodex and a #11 cap. A few years back, as a result of an elk hunt, I switched to a Noexcuses 460 grain conical with 80 grains of 3F 777 and a CCI magnum #11 cap.. It works as well on deer as it did on elk and shoots plenty flat and accurate out to 100 yards, which is as far as I will shoot with it.. In fact I don't think I ever took a shot at game with it over 75 or 80 yards.
